Pool Heating Sydney: Your Complete Guide to Year-Round Swimming

If you’ve ever avoided your pool during Sydney’s cooler months, you’re not alone. While Sydney enjoys mild winters compared to other cities, water temperatures can drop to uncomfortable levels between April and October. Pool heating Sydney solutions have become increasingly popular among homeowners who want to maximize their pool investment and enjoy comfortable swimming temperatures all year round.

According to recent industry data, over 13% of new pool owners in Sydney now install heating systems during construction, and that number continues to grow. Whether you’re planning a swimming pool renovation or looking to upgrade your existing pool, understanding your heating options is essential.

Why Pool Heating Makes Sense in Sydney

Sydney’s climate offers approximately 240 sunny days per year, yet natural water temperatures only reach comfortable swimming levels (25-28°C) for about four months. Without heating, your pool sits unused for two-thirds of the year, representing a significant underutilization of your investment.

Types of Pool Heating Systems Available in Sydney

Choosing the right pool heating system depends on your budget, pool size, usage patterns, and environmental preferences. Here’s a comprehensive comparison of the main options:

1. Heat Pump Pool Heating

Heat pumps are currently the most popular choice for Sydney homeowners, and for good reason. These systems extract warmth from the surrounding air and transfer it to your pool water, operating similarly to a reverse-cycle air conditioner.

Advantages:

  • Energy-efficient operation with COP ratings up to 15.0
  • Lower running costs compared to gas heating
  • Environmentally friendly with minimal emissions
  • Consistent heating regardless of cloud cover
  • Relatively quiet operation

Considerations:

  • Higher upfront cost ($3,000-$6,000 installed)
  • Performance decreases in temperatures below 10°C
  • Takes longer to heat pools initially (24-48 hours)

2. Solar Pool Heating

Solar heating harnesses Sydney’s abundant sunshine to warm your pool naturally. Solar panels (typically installed on your roof) circulate pool water through heated collectors.

Advantages:

  • Virtually zero running costs after installation
  • Environmentally sustainable option
  • Can extend swimming season by 3-4 months
  • Low maintenance requirements
  • Government rebates may be available

Considerations:

  • Dependent on sunny weather and daylight hours
  • Requires adequate roof space (panels need 50-100% of pool surface area)
  • Initial installation cost ($3,500-$7,000)
  • Less effective during prolonged cloudy periods

3. Gas Pool Heating

Natural gas or LPG heaters provide rapid heating, making them ideal for occasional use or quick temperature boosts.

Advantages:

  • Heats pools quickly (1.5°C per hour)
  • Works in any weather condition
  • Ideal for spas and smaller pools
  • On-demand heating capability

Considerations:

  • Highest ongoing running costs
  • Environmental impact from gas combustion
  • Requires natural gas connection or LPG bottles
  • Initial cost: $2,500-$5,500 installed

Pool Heating Cost Sydney: What to Expect

Understanding the true cost of pool heating involves both installation and ongoing operational expenses. Here’s a detailed breakdown:

Heating TypeInstallation CostAnnual Running Cost*Best For
Heat Pump$3,000 – $6,000$400 – $800Year-round use
Solar$3,500 – $7,000$50 – $150Extended season
Gas (Natural)$2,500 – $5,000$1,200 – $2,500Occasional use
Gas (LPG)$2,000 – $4,500$1,500 – $3,000Quick heating

*Based on standard 40,000L pool, maintaining 26°C, 8 months per year

The actual running costs depend on several factors:

  • Pool size and depth
  • Desired temperature settings
  • Use of pool covers
  • Local climate conditions
  • Insulation and wind exposure

“Investing in a quality pool cover can reduce heating costs by 50-70%,” explains pool maintenance expert Sarah Chen. “It’s the single most cost-effective upgrade you can make alongside your heating system.”

Choosing the Right Pool Heating System

Selecting the optimal heating solution requires careful consideration of your specific circumstances:

Choose Heat Pumps if:

  • You want year-round swimming capability
  • Energy efficiency is a priority
  • You’re willing to invest more upfront for lower running costs
  • Your pool location has good air circulation

Choose Solar Heating if:

  • You have suitable roof space facing north
  • Environmental sustainability is important
  • You’re comfortable with weather-dependent heating
  • You want minimal ongoing costs

Choose Gas Heating if:

  • You need rapid heating on demand
  • Your pool is used sporadically (weekends, entertaining)
  • You have natural gas already connected
  • You want guaranteed heating regardless of weather

Many Sydney homeowners opt for hybrid systems, combining solar heating with a gas or heat pump booster for optimal efficiency and reliability.

Maintaining Your Pool Heating System

Regular maintenance ensures your heating system operates efficiently for years:

Monthly Tasks:

  • Check and clean filter systems
  • Monitor water chemistry balance
  • Inspect for leaks or unusual noises

Quarterly Tasks:

  • Clean heat exchanger (for heat pumps)
  • Check refrigerant levels (heat pumps)
  • Inspect solar panels for debris or damage

Annual Professional Service:

  • Comprehensive system inspection
  • Component testing and adjustment
  • Efficiency optimization

Pool heating systems integrated properly with your overall pool maintenance routine can last 10-15 years with proper care.

Maximizing Heating Efficiency

Beyond choosing the right system, these strategies help reduce heating costs:

  • Use pool covers religiously: Prevents 70% of heat loss through evaporation
  • Windbreaks: Strategic landscaping reduces wind chill
  • Optimal temperature: Each degree above 26°C increases costs by 10-15%
  • Timer settings: Heat during off-peak electricity periods
  • Regular maintenance: Clean filters improve circulation efficiency

Q1. How much does it cost to heat a pool in Sydney?

Running costs vary significantly based on heating type and usage. Heat pumps typically cost $400-$800 annually, solar heating $50-$150, while gas heating can exceed $2,000 per year. Using a pool cover can reduce these costs by up to 70%.

Q2. What's the most cost-effective pool heating option in Sydney?

Solar heating offers the lowest running costs but requires suitable roof space and consistent sunshine. Heat pumps provide the best balance of efficiency and reliability for year-round use, with moderate running costs and excellent performance in Sydney's climate.

Q3. How long does it take to heat a pool in Sydney?

This depends on your heating system. Gas heaters can raise temperature by 1.5°C per hour, heating a standard pool in 6-8 hours. Heat pumps typically take 24-48 hours for initial heating but maintain temperature efficiently. Solar heating gradually warms pools over several days.

4. Can I install pool heating in an existing pool?

Absolutely. Pool heating can be retrofitted to any existing pool regardless of age or type. Professional installation ensures proper integration with your current filtration system. Many homeowners coordinate heating installation during pool renovations or resurfacing projects.
